How to form an equation?
Determine the known quantities and designate the unknown quantity as a variable while trying to set up or construct a linear equation to fit a real-world application.
In other words, an equation is a set of variables that are constrained through a situation or case.
Let's say your final score is x
Given that,
Your final score x is 12 points less than your friend's final score.
So,
x = friend final score - 12
Now,
Friend final score = 195
So,
x = 195 - 12
x + 12 = 195
195 = x + 12
Now,
x = 195 - 12 = 183
Hence "The equation formed using the given data is 195 = x + 12 and your final score is 183 points".
